Block 519,913
Block Hash
231a42d0e7dfc5171d4216460b6cea2e60f9c7075d1465a39adbb01a21
892488
Previous Block Hash
dcd48367050783ea634514bd81ff3f2d40bdba2d29bed339892a13c1e1 7bd7f9
Mined
Transactions
2
Difficulty
26.55 M
Size
397 bytes
Transactions (2)
1 input, 1 output
15,625.0144
PEPE
1 input, 2 outputs
1,247,310.606671
PEPE